Delivery System
The ability of Catalase-SKL
to gain entry into the peroxisome and, once there, to metabolize hydrogen
peroxide, is dependent on the enzyme first having accessed the cell interior.
That is, catalase must be delivered inside the cell. To achieve this goal, EXT
has adopted a protein “transduction” strategy, whereby Catalase-SKL is either
mixed with a delivery molecule prior to the addition to cells, or a delivery
motif is fused to the end of the catalase molecule (opposite of where the SKL
signal is positioned). By either method, Catalase-SKL is transduced across the
cell’s plasma membrane and enters the cytosol. Catalase-SKL is then poised to
engage the peroxisomal protein import apparatus and enter the peroxisome.
Experiments are currently underway to optimize Catalase-SKL delivery
efficiencies for a wide range of cell and tissue types.
